On 2019/12/12 1:26, Marc Zyngier wrote:
> On 2019-12-10 02:08, Qianggui Song wrote:
>> Hi, Marc
>>      Thank you for your review
>>
>> On 2019/12/6 21:13, Marc Zyngier wrote:
>>> On 2019-12-06 12:17, Qianggui Song wrote:
>>>> Since Meson-A1 Socs register layout of gpio interrupt controller 
>>>> have
>>>> difference with previous chips, registers to decide irq line and
>>>> offset
>>>> of trigger method are all changed, the current driver should be
>>>> modified.
>>>>
>>>> Signed-off-by: Qianggui Song <qianggui.song@...ogic.com>
>>>> ---
>>>>  drivers/irqchip/irq-meson-gpio.c | 79
>>>> ++++++++++++++++++++++++--------
>>>>  1 file changed, 60 insertions(+), 19 deletions(-)

>>> Please place the #defines that operate on the various data 
>>> structures
>>> *after* the definition of the structures. It would greatly help
>>> reading the changes.
>>>
>> OK, will place it below the definition of struct 
>> meson_gpio_irq_params
>> in the next patch.

>>> OK, this isn't great. The least you could do is to make
>>> your initializer parametric, so that it takes the nr_hwirq as
>>> a parameter.
>>>
>>> Then, any additional member that overrides common behaviour
>>> should come after the main initializer.
>>>
>>> Also, do you need 'support_edge_both'? Isn't a non-zero
>>> 'edge_both_offset' enough to detect the feature?
>>>
>>
>> Sorry, but I am not very clear that "make your initializer 
>> parametric,
>> so that it takes the nr_hwirq as a parameter". Is that
>> initializer(initial function in .ops ? ) as a parameter of struct
>> meson_gpio_irq_params ? If nr_hwirq as a parameter of init function 
>> of
>> .ops then will make lot of init function for each platform.
>>
